174592. lajstromszámú szabadalom • Eljárás és berendezés hírközlő kapcsoló berendezéshez tartozó számítógépes adatfeldolgozó rendszer üzemi terhelésénak szabályozására
5 174592 6 lálóregiszterben tárolt feldolgozott új hívások NCP számával. A CR3 komparátor Y3 kimenete akkor van aktivált állapotban, amikor az NCP szám legfeljebb egyenlő az NCO számértékkel (vagy az NC1, vagy NC2, vagy NC3 számértékkel) és ez az Y3 kimenet C6 vonalon keresztül a GA4 ÉS kapu rendszer egyik bemenetéhez csatlakozik, — 5 helyértékű számlálóból képzett üzemi terhelés WLR regisztert, a WLR regiszternek Up felfelé számláló bemenete, Dn lefelé számláló bemenete és 0, 1 ... 4 kimenetei vannak. A Dn lefelé számláló bemenet a G ÉS kapun keresztül a CR1 komparátor Y1 kimenetéhez csatlakozik, és a G ÉS kaput az I inverteren keresztül a WLR regiszter O kimenete is vezérli, miközben az Up felfelé számláló bemenet közvetlenül a CR2 komparátor Y2 kimenetéhez csatlakozik. Az üzemi terhelés WLR regiszter 0... 3 kimenetei a GAO ... GA3 ÉS kapu rendszereken keresztül a CR3 komparátor egyik bemenetéhez csatlakoznak, és az említett ÉS kapu rendszereket a GC kapuáramkörön keresztül az RNCO . . . RNC3 regiszterek vezérlik. Az üzemi terhelés WLR regiszter 4 kimenete riasztókimenet, — CL1 óragenerátort, amely 10 milliszekundumos időközönként 2 mikroszekundumos kimeneti impulzusokat hoz létre, és a c7 vonalon keresztül vezérli a CPA hívásfeldolgozó elrendezést. A CL1 óragenerátor egy c8 vonalon keresztül CL2 óragenerátort is vezérel, és alkalmas a BS bistabil áramkör törlésére, a CL2 óragenerátor 100 milliszekundumos időközönként 2 mikroszekundumos kimeneti impulzusokat hoz létre. Ezt a CL2 óragenerátort az említett módon a c8 vonalon keresztül a CL1 óragenerátor vezérli, és alkalmas az RNCP számlálóregiszter törlésére és a c9 vonalon keresztül a CR1 és CR2 komparátorok aktiválására. Alkalmas továbbá a clO vonalon és a DC késleltető áramkörön keresztül az FTC szabadidő számláló törlésére is, — a CL3 óragenerátor 25 mikroszekundumos időközökben 2 mikroszekundumos kimeneti impulzusokat hoz létre. A CL3 óragenerátort a BS bistabil áramkör 1-es kimenete vezérli, és alkalmas a cll vonalon keresztül az FTC szabadidő számláló léptetésére, ha az említett 1-es kimenet aktiválódik. A fentiekben hivatkozott GC kapuáramkört a cc vezérlővonalon keresztül a CPA hívásfeldolgozó elrendezés vezérli, és alkalmas a MÉM tárban levő áramkörök és a PR processzorban levő áramkörök ideiglenes összekötésére. Pontosabban kifejezve a CPA hívásfeldolgozó elrendezés oly módon vezérli a GC kapuáramkört, hogy időszakos kapcsolat jön létre az alábbi egységek között: — A CPA hívásfeldolgozó elrendezés c2 vonalhoz csatlakozó kimenete és a CH hívásugrató között, amikor a CPA hívásfeldolgozó elrendezés a TSE kapcsolóberendezéstől adatokat gyűjt, — a CH hívásugrató és a CPA hívásfeldolgozó elrendezés c3 vonalhoz csatlakozó bemenete között, amikor a CPA hívásfeldolgozó elrendezés adatokat próbál kivonni a CH hivásugratóból, — a CPA hívásfeldolgozó elrendezés c4 vonalhoz csatlakozó kimenete és a RNCP számlálóregiszter között minden olyan alkalommal, amikor a CPA hívásfeldolgozó elrendezés új hívással kapcsolatos adatokat dolgozott fel, — az RFT1 regiszter és a CR1 komparátor, az RFT2 regiszter és a CR2 komparátor, valamint az FTC szabadidőszámláló és a CRI, CR2 komparátorok között az egyes 100 milliszekundumos időtartamok kezdetekor, — az RNCP számlálóregiszter és a CR3 komparátor, az RNCO .. . RNC3 regiszterek és a CR3 komparátor között mindenkor, amikor a CPA hívásfeldolgozó elrendezés adatokat próbál kivonni a CH hivásugratóból. A fentiekben vázolt számítógép MÉM tára és PR processzora alkalmas a TSE kapcsolóberendezésen keresztül történő hírközlés létesítésének, felügyeletének és bontásának vezérlésére, mégpedig olyan módon, hogy egymás után magasabb és alacsonyabb elsőbbségű feladatokat, vagy óra- és alapszintű programokat hajt végre, például a 3 557 315 számú USA szabadalmi leírásban ismertetett módon. A számítógép ezen magasabb elsőbbségű feladatok végrehajtását minden 10 milliszekundumban elkezdi, és amikor ezen feladatokat befejezte és megfelelő idő áll rendelkezésre, akkor hozzálát az alacsonyabb elsőbbségű feladatok végrehajtásához. Ha a számítógép normális terhelési körülmények mellett üzemel, akkor ezen alacsonyabb elsőbbségű feladatokat már befejezi mielőtt a következő 10 milliszekundumos időköz elkezdődne. Ezzel összhangban 10 milliszekundumos időközönként, amikor a számítógép átlagos üzemi terhelés mellett működik, rendszerint bizonyos szabadon hozzáférhető idővel is rendelkezik. Világos, hogy amikor a számítógép terhelése növekszik, akkor a hozzáférhető szabadidő csökken, és viszont. Mivel ez a szabadidő az említett tulajdonságú, egyúttal a számítógép üzemi terheltségét és foglaltsági szintjét is kifejezi. A számítógép a túlterheléstől való védelem céljából tartalmaz egy foglaltsági szintet megállapító szervet, amelyet az 1. ábrán vázoltunk, és ez olyan módon állapítja meg a számítógép foglaltsági szintjét, hogy megméri a választott 100 milliszekundumos időtartam egységenként a hozzáférhető szabadidőt, tartalmaz továbbá a 2. ábrán vázolt üzemi terhelést szabályozó szervet, amely a számítógép üzemi terhelésének egy részét a megállapított foglaltsági szinttől függően szabályozza. Ezt az alábbiakban ismertetjük. A számítógép a fentiekben leírtakkal összhangban minden 10 milliszekundumban hozzáfog egy sorozat nagyobb elsőbbségű feladat végrehajtásához, és amikor ezeket befejezte, és hozzáférhető idővel rendelkezik, akkor alacsonyabb elsőbbségű feladatok sorozatát hajtja végre. A magasabb elsőbbségű feladatok egyike a tárolt DNC adatoknak az öss^yűjtése, amely adatok az új hívásokra vonatkoznak. Ezen új DNC adatokat a CPA hívásfeldolgozó elrendezés révén a cl vonalon keresztül a 5 10 15 20 25 30 35 40 45 50 55 60 65 3